Most airlines use even number for west bound flights and odd for the east bound, Air France seem to do the opposit, any reason???

No French jokes yet? :) Doing a search, it was stated that AF assigns flights leaving the "hub" as even numbers. The return is odd, usually +1. The Concorde flights were an exception.
